What is the basic strategy in blackjack?
The basic strategy in blackjack is a mathematically derived approach that dictates the optimal action based on your hand and the dealer’s visible card. This strategy aims to reduce the house edge to as low as **0.5%**. The fundamental actions include:
- Hit: Take another card if your hand is below 12.
- Stand: Keep your current hand if you have 17 or more.
- Double Down: Double your bet and receive one additional card, typically when your initial hand totals 10 or 11.
- Split: If you have a pair, split them into two separate hands for a chance at more winnings.
How does card counting work?
Card counting involves keeping track of the ratio of high to low cards left in the deck. This strategy is predicated on the premise that high cards (10s, face cards, and Aces) favour the player, while low cards favour the dealer. The most common systems include:
- Hi-Lo System: Assigns values of +1 to cards 2-6, 0 to 7-9, and -1 to 10-Ace. A higher positive count suggests a higher proportion of high cards remaining.
- KO System: A “knock-out” method that eliminates the need for a true count, making it easier for beginners.
While card counting is not illegal, casinos reserve the right to refuse service to players suspected of employing this method.
